ABOUT INTER IKEA GROUP

The purpose of Inter IKEA Group is to secure continuous improvement, development, expansion and a long life of the IKEA Concept. It has three core businesses: Franchise, Range & Supply and Industry.

• Inter IKEA Systems B.V. is the owner of the IKEA Concept and the worldwide IKEA franchisor. The assignment is to continuously develop the IKEA Concept and to ensure its successful implementation in existing and new markets. 11 different groups of companies own and operate IKEA sales channels under franchise agreements with Inter IKEA Systems B.V. A large group of franchisees are owned & operated by INGKA Group. Inter IKEA Systems B.V. also assigns different IKEA companies to develop range, supply and communication.

• IKEA Range & Supply is responsible for developing and supplying the global IKEA range. This means working with the whole value chain: from the needs and wants of the many people, through product development and the sourcing of raw materials, to a product’s end-of-life.

• IKEA Industry is the largest producer of wooden furniture in the world and manufactures wood-based furniture for the IKEA product range.
